Approximaatioalgoritmit
Approximaatioalgoritmit ovat tietotekniikassa ja matematiikassa käytettyjä algoritmeja, jotka tarjoavat likimääräisiä ratkaisuja ongelmiin, joiden tarkat ratkaisut ovat vaikeita tai mahdottomia laskea tehokkaasti. Näitä algoritmeja käytetään erityisesti NP-kovien ongelmien, kuten matkustavan kauppiaan ongelman tai pakkaamisen ongelman, ratkaisemiseen, kun tarkat ratkaisut vaativat liian paljon laskentaa tai ovat käytännössä mahdottomia.
Approksimaatioalgoritmit perustuvat yleensä joko heikkoihin tai vahvoihin approksimaatio-guaranteeihin. Heikko approksimaatio takaa ratkaisun, joka on tietyn suhteen
Esimerkkejä approksimaatioalgoritmeista ovat esimerkiksi matkustavan kauppiaan ongelman ratkaisemiseen käytetty Christofidesin algoritmi, joka takaa ratkaisun, joka on
Approksimaatioalgoritmeja käytetään laajalti käytännön sovelluksissa, kuten logistiikassa, talousmatematiikassa ja tietokoneverkkojen suunnittelussa. Niiden etuna on, että ne
Approksimaatioalgoritmien kehitys on aktiivinen tutkimusala, jossa pyritään parantamaan niiden suorituskykyä ja luotettavuutta. Tutkimus keskittyy muun muassa